Anita Pallenberg (born April 6th 1942, Rome, Italy) was a German actress, model, and fashion designer. She worked on the film 'Performance' (1970) from the early stages, being one of the often uncredited writers, as well as one of the stars. Pallenberg was the woman who popularized the bohemian look, as opposed to mod-swinging London. By 1967, she had started helping her boyfriend, Keith Richards, dress. Almost all of Richard's 'iconic' style can be traced back to her and her closet. Richards claims "I was considered for a while, like, the best-dressed man in the world. It was because I was wearing Anita’s clothes.” Pallenberg has been cited as one of the main influences for British model Kate Moss as well, yet another rockstar trapped in a model's body. She was the romantic partner of Rolling Stones Keith Richards, from 1967 to 1979, by whom she has two children.
